There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
detailsmay carry sensitive values (e.g., an encryption passphrase). CloudStack’s Gson logging usesLoggingExclusionStrategywith@LogLevelto exclude fields, so leaving this unannotated can leak secrets in debug logs. Annotatedetailswith@LogLevel(Off)(or avoid putting secrets in this map).
